WebbThe Higgs boson is a particle that helps transmit the mass giving Higgs field, similar to the way a particle of light, the photon, transmits the EM field. The Higgs boson is, if nothing else, the most expensive particle of all time, while finding the Higgs boson required the creation of experimental energies rarely seen before on planet Earth. WebbThe mass of an atom is mostly localized to the nucleus. Because an electron has negligible mass relative to that of a proton or a neutron, the mass number is calculated by the sum … WebbThe neutron is a neutral particle, which is stable only in the confines of the nucleus of the atom. Outside the nucleus the neutron decays with a mean lifetime of about 15 min. Its mass, like that of the proton, is equivalent to 1 amu (atomic mass unit).
